§ 34-8-74. Appointment, Compensation, Powers, and Duties of Personnel Administering Chapter

Universal Citation: GA Code § 34-8-74 (2021)

Subject to other provisions of this chapter, the Commissioner is authorized to appoint, fix the compensation of, and prescribe the duties and powers of such officers, accountants, attorneys, experts, and other persons as may be necessary in the performance of the Commissioner's duties under this chapter. The Commissioner may delegate to any such person such power and authority as deemed reasonable and proper for the effective administration of this chapter and may, in the discretion of the Commissioner, bond any persons handling moneys or signing checks under this chapter.

(Code 1981, §34-8-74, enacted by Ga. L. 1991, p. 139, § 1.)
